Fishermen kidnapped, ransom demanded

A ransom of US $10,000 has been demanded for the safe release of three fishermen who were kidnapped at sea.

Keith Schneider aka “Carlo”, one man who goes by the alias “Sacks” and a Venezuelan man left Icacos around 5:00am on Tuesday. Witnesses say seven Venezuelan men approached their boat, German 1, and held them at gunpoint. The pirates then forced the fishermen into their boat and stole German 1’s engine. The men were last seen being covered in the pirate’s boat.

A media release by Fishermen and Friends of the Sea has confirmed that a ransom has been demanded for the men’s release. No other information is available at this time.

Investigations are continuing.
